About

Matthew Paige "Matt" Damon, born on October 8, 1970 in Cambridge, Massachusetts, is an acclaimed American actor, producer, and screenplay writer. Rising to prominence with the successful 1997 film "Good Will Hunting", which he co-wrote and co-starred in with Ben Affleck, Damon won the Academy Award for Best Original Screenplay. Known for his numerous versatile roles, his most notable film projects include the "Bourne" series, "Saving Private Ryan", "The Martian", and "Ocean's" trilogy. Apart from his acting career, Damon is also recognized for his charity work, particularly with organizations that focus on clean water and environmental sustainability projects.

FAQs

What Is the Most Popular Matt Damon Movie/TV Show?

One of the most popular movies starring Matt Damon is "Good Will Hunting" (1997), for which he won an Academy Award for Best Original Screenplay alongside co-writer Ben Affleck and earned a nomination for Best Actor. Playing the brilliant mathematician with a difficult past, Will Hunting, Damon offers an iconic performance. Although Damon has appeared in numerous popular films, including the "Bourne" series and "The Martian," "Good Will Hunting" is often recognized as a career-defining role and an enduring classic in modern American cinema.

How Did Matt Damon Get Famous?

Matt Damon gained fame through his breakout role in the movie "Good Will Hunting" in 1997, which he co-wrote and starred in with his friend Ben Affleck. The film was a critical and commercial success and won two Academy Awards, including Best Original Screenplay for Damon and Affleck. This victory catapulted him to stardom, establishing him as a proficient actor and writer in Hollywood. His versatile and highly-acclaimed performances in various subsequent films solidified his position in the film industry, making him one of the most recognizable and respected names in Hollywood.
